MySQL 中 AND、OR 和 AS 的规则:AND:条件全真时为真,优先级高于 OR;OR:条件一真时为真,优先级低于 AND;AS:为选择列指定别名,后跟列别名。

MySQL 中 AND、OR 和 AS 的规则
AND
- 将两个或多个条件组合在一起,只有当所有条件都为真时,整个表达式才为真。
- AND 运算符的优先级高于 OR 运算符。
- 语法:
condition1 AND condition2
OR
- 将两个或多个条件组合在一起,只要其中一个条件为真,整个表达式就为真。
- OR 运算符的优先级低于 AND 运算符。
- 语法:
condition1 OR condition2
AS
- 为从查询中选择的列指定别名。
- AS 关键字后跟列别名。
- 语法:
SELECT column_name AS column_alias
规则
- AND 和 OR 运算符可以组合使用。
- AS 别名可以与 AND 和 OR 运算符一起使用。
- 括号可以用来控制运算符的优先级。
-
例如:
<code>SELECT * FROM table_name WHERE (column1 = value1 OR column2 = value2) AND column3 = value3 AS result_alias;</code>
在这个查询中:
-
OR运算符将column1和column2的条件组合在一起。 -
AND运算符将OR运算符的条件与column3的条件组合在一起。 -
AS关键字为查询结果指定别名为result_alias。










